Kansas Wildlife & Parks Commission Meeting

June 18, 2026 - Lindsborg, KS

  • Date: 06/18/2026 12:00 p.m. - 5:00 p.m.  

June 18, 2026 Meeting Details 

Meeting Attendance Options

In Person

J.O. Sundstrom Conference Center
102 N Main Street
Lindsborg, KS  

If notified in advance, KDWP will have an interpreter available for the hearing impaired. To request an interpreter, call the Kansas Commission of Deaf and Hard of Hearing at 1-800-432-0698. Any individual with a disability may request other accommodations by contacting KDWP at 785-294-2645.

Agenda

 I.     Call to Order at 12:00pm

II.     Introduction of Commissioners and Guests

III.   Additions and Deletions of Agenda Items

IV.   Approval of April 2026 Meeting Minutes

V.     Department Report

a) Public Hearing (Administrative Rules and Regulations, Pursuant to KSA 77-421)

  • 115-2-1 Night Vision Hunting and Duplicate Boat Decal Fees—Jon Beckmann

b) Regulations in Promulgation — Kurtis Wiard

  • 115-2-2 and 115-2-3 Park Fees: Completed promulgation and ratification; will be voted on at August 26, 2026 Meeting
  • 115-25-9s Deer Seasons on Military Units: Currently with Attorney General
  • 115-8-1 Nonresident Waterfowl Hunting on Public Lands: Currently with Attorney General
  • 115-8-25 Trail Cameras on Public Lands: Currently with Kansas Department of Administration

VI.    Secretary's Remarks—Secretary Christopher Kennedy

VII.  General Public Comment*

VIII. Informational Items

IX.    General Discussion

a)115-25-14 Fishing; creel limit, size limit, possession limit, and open season—Bryan Sowards

X.     Workshop Session

a) 115-25-5 and 115- 25-6 Turkey Fall Season—Jake George

b) 115-2-1 Nonresident Waterfowl Stamp Fees; Senior Licenses—Jake George

XI.   General Public Comment*

XII.  Old Business

*All public comments are limited to ten minutes per presenter. Presenters who need additional time to speak may request up to an additional five minutes from the Chair.
